The renewal of our three-year agreement with Torvane Materials has been assessed in detail. Proposed terms include a 4.2% unit-price increase, partially offset by improved volume rebates and extended payment terms of sixty days. Sensitivity analysis indicates a net annual cost impact of under 1% on the Meridia product line, assuming stable demand. Legal has flagged no material changes to liability clauses. We recommend approval, subject to the conditions outlined in the confidential note below.

confidential, yawip-bahif: Zorokox Partners plans to lower the Casax list price by 28.0 percent in April. The board signed off on a budget of $271.0 million for Project Juldor. The renewal with Pelokox Partners closes at $410.1 million a year, 3.4 percent below the last contract. Project Pelok slips by a full year because of the audit delay.

**Ticket: Deep links bouncing to the web fallback — Mapletide app**

Hey, welcome aboard! Quick one for you: deep links on the staging build keep kicking users to the browser instead of the app. Turns out the link-resolver container was deployed without its verification secret, so every route check fails. Open the resolver's env file and add the secret on the next line.

env line for fafof-fahag: LEDGER_TOKEN5=f8790

TICKET: TideGlass widget shows stale high-tide rows after midnight rollover. Repro: open the Harborline dashboard for Port Vesk after 00:00 local; table still shows yesterday's cycle until hard refresh. Suspect the memoized lunar-offset cache keyed on UTC date, not station-local date. Affects all stations west of the Merrow meridian config. Severity: P2, customer-visible. Workaround: force cache bust via admin panel. Fix should land before spring tide week. The failing build is identified below.

pipeline stamp: htk31_0320b403a7d85d795607a9e75b13f71

## Deployment

Snipframe CLI ships as a single static binary. Drop it on the batch host, point it at your plugin directory, and run `snipframe verify` before enabling cron. Plugins load in lexical order; name yours accordingly. Resource limits are enforced per worker, not per job. Do not bundle your own image codecs. Before first run, the daemon reads the following configuration values from its environment.

config for kafof-bawef:
holath:
  log_level: debug
  metrics_host: metrics.holath.qorvelsys.internal
  pin: 2191
  pool_size: 32